Sliding panels system for hiding a flat screen TV
5FIELD OF THE INVENTION
[001] The present invention relates generally to sliding panels but more
particularly to sliding panels system for hiding a flat screen TV.
BACKGROUND OF THE INVENTION
[002] Flat screen TVs are quite common but their huge sizes are not always
appreciated in some home decor. There has to be a practical way of
hiding the screens. There does not seem to be readily available screen
hiding devices in the marketplace.

[005] In order to do so, the invention consists of a sliding panels system for
CA 02814263 2013-04-26
2
hiding a flat screen television having a frame structure consisting of a
wall attachment panel adapted to be securely attached to a wall
member, a pair of post members spaced from one another and attached
to the wall attachment panel, Upper and lower rail assemblies are
extendable, spaced apart, and parallel to one another and attached
between the post members. A first side support bracket assembly
connected between the upper and lower rail assemblies on first ends
thereof, and a second side support bracket assembly connected
between the upper and lower rail assemblies on second ends thereof,
such that the space between the first and second support bracket
assemblies can be adjusted by the extendable upper and lower rail
assemblies; and first and second panel members respectively attached
to the first and second support bracket assemblies, such that the first
and second panel members can be moved between an open position
wherein the panel members are spaced apart and a closed position
wherein the panel members are abutting one another.
[006] The sliding panels system is preferably comprised of a looped
cable forming an upper loop portion and a lower loop portion, the upper
loop portion attached at one point to a first portion of the extendable
upper rail assembly via a first connector, and the lower loop portion
attached at a second point to a second portion of the extendable upper
rail assembly that is movable from the first portion of the upper rail
assembly via a second connector. When the looped cable is rotated in
CA 02814263 2013-04-26 "
3
one direction, the extendable upper and lower rail members extend
outwards and move the first and second panel members away from one
another, and when the looped cable is rotated in the opposite direction,
the extendable upper and lower rail members retract inwards and move
the first and second panel members towards one another.
[007] The sliding panels system has the extendable upper rail
assembly include an elongated bracket member extending a length
upon the upper rail assembly that is greater than a maximum width of
the space between the first and second panel members when the upper
rail assembly is fully extended; and wherein the elongated bracket
member includes a pulley member on each opposite end portion
thereof, such that the looped cable is wrapped around both pulleys
forming a taught elongated loop.
[008] In a preferred embodiment, the sliding panels system has the
upper rail assembly bracket member include an electric motor assembly
located on an end portion thereof adjacent one of the pulley members>
The electric motor assembly includes an electric motor, a motor wheel,
a motor cable, and a transmission adapted to allow the motor wheel to
turn in forward and reverse directions, wherein the motor cable is
adapted to be connected between the motor wheel and the one of the
pulley members, such that the electric motor assembly is adapted to
mechanically open and close the first and second panel members.
CA 02814263 2013-04-26
4
[009] The sliding panels system has the upper and lower rail
assemblies each formed from two respective telescoping inner and
outer rail members, such that the first connector is connected to a first
telescoping part of the upper rail assembly, and the second connector is
connected to a second telescoping part of the upper rail assembly.
[0010] In a preferred embodiment, the sliding panels system has the
sliding panels are opened and closed by way of a remote control
device.
[0011] The sliding panels work in combination with a flat screen
television.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ENT
[0023] A sliding panels system (10) for hiding a flat screen TV (12) has a
frame
structure comprised of a wall attachment panel (15) attached to a wall
15 (11) on one
side and connected to a pair of generally vertical post
CA 02814263 2013-04-26
7
members (26) on the other side. The vertical post members (26) hold
upper and lower rail assemblies (14, 14') perpendicularly therefrom. The
rail assemblies (14, 14') are telescopic in nature, meaning that there is
an inner rail members (13) sliding out from outer rail members (17). The
rail assemblies are connected by way of support brackets (18) to panels
(28).
[0024] A looped cable (20) is what pulls on the rail assemblies (14, 14')
either
apart or together so as to move the panels (28). The cable (20) is
arranged in a "clothes line" fashion with a first connector (30) attached to
the part of the looped cable (20) that runs top part of the cable (20) and a
second connector (30') attached to the part of the cable (20) running on
the bottom. The cable (20) is part of an assembly comprised of pulleys
(22) and at least one electric motor assembly (24).
[0025] The motor assembly (24) is comprised of an electric motor (not shown),
a
transmission (not shown) and a motor wheel (32) as is known in the art
and held in place by way of a motor assembly bracket (25).
[0026] Typically, a remote control device comprised of a remote unit (30) and
an
an associated signal receiver (not shown) control the opening and
closing of the sliding panels system (10). Alternatively, or a wall switch
(not shown) can also control the opening and closing.
